Transaction 38d1c361d03f1452b28d3acd50cb8d8e6985b4b102652733f6123ddb31db6683

59 Input
2 Outputs
  • 38d1c361d03f1452b28d3acd50cb8d8e6985b4b102652733f6123ddb31db6683:0
  • value  7532990
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e
  • 38d1c361d03f1452b28d3acd50cb8d8e6985b4b102652733f6123ddb31db6683:1
  • value  1689953
    address  3JSdUu1ivm3rqMvuCTAdAj6Dc2hdVhHiEe